DUNAS BEACH RESORT
The ground breaking ceremony of Dunas Beach Resort on the Island of Sal in Cape Verde took place on 13 November 2009.
The Prime Minister had graciously agreed to preside over the event but was unfortunately taken ill a couple of days before. It was, however, an honour that the Minister of State attended in his place. Activities commenced with the Minister of State and Rob Jarrett, Chairman of The Resort Group, using golden shovels to pour the first block of concrete and then laid a ceremonial stone. As is tradition, a lucky ¤1 coin was thrown into the block and champagne bottles were popped as the attendees drank a congratulatory toast.
Also in attendance were the Secretary of State for the Economy, a representative of the Mayor of Sal, the President of the CI and many other Dignitaries from the various authorities of Cape Verde.
The ground breaking activity was organised and supervised by construction company Grupo San Jose and their joint venture partner Sogei.
Guests were then invited to a reception at the Hotel Odjo D'Agua in Santa Maria where Champagne, Caipirinhas and Canapes were waiting on arrival.
On the way back to Santa Maria, the Dignitaries were taken on an interesting diversion as they were given a tour of Tortuga Beach Resort & Spa just down the beach. Tortuga is the first project that The Resort Group undertook on the Island of Sal and it was only in January of this year that the Ground Breaking event took place with the Prime Minister. Everyone agreed that the progress of Tortuga has been nothing short of amazing. Grupo San Jose and Sogei have worked relentlessly and the 300 or so workers, mainly from the local workforce, were acknowledged as being an absolute credit to Cape Verde (there will be some 500 workers employed on the construction of Dunas).
At the Hotel Odjo D'Agua the formal speeches then followed starting with a presentation on the Dunas project by developer The Resort Group. This included the positive reasons why Cape Verde and the Island of Sal were chosen and that the Resort has bucked the trend during the current worldwide economic uncertainty, evidenced by nearly 600 of the Villas and Apartments already being sold (which represents more than 2/3rds). Dunas will also include a 5-Star Hotel with a variety of quality restaurants, elegant and stylish bars, state of the art gymnasium, luxury spa, sports facilities, huge communal pools, shops and all the amenities you would expect from a 5-Star Resort. Over ¤80 million will be invested into Dunas making it a Resort that everyone can be proud of.
The next speech gave thanks, on behalf of the Chairman and everyone at The Resort Group, to the Minister of State for presiding over the event and all associated parties for their support of Dunas Beach Resort.
